25% of 30 - getcalc. com 7 5 is 25 percent of 30 In offers and discount, 25 off 30 generally represents 25 percent off in $30 25% off $30 is equal to $7 5 It means the discount price is $7 5, so $7 5 has to be deducted from $30 Therefore, the discounted price is $22 5

What is 25 percent of 30? - Percent-off Calculator What is 25 percent of 30? 25% of 30 is 7 5 To calculate 25 of 30 you just need to multiply the percent value (25) by the quantity (30) then divide the result by one hundred Percentage

Percentage Calculator For example, 35% is equivalent to the decimal 0 35, or the fractions Percentages are computed by multiplying the value of a ratio by 100 For example, if 25 out of 50 students in a classroom are male, The value of the ratio is therefore 0 5, and multiplying this by 100 yields: 0 5 × 100 = 50
